What is the national drink of the Dominican Republic?

The national drink of the Dominican Republic is Mama Juana, a traditional drink made from a combination of rum, red wine, and honey, which is soaked in a bottle with tree bark and herbs. The drink is often served as a shot or used as an ingredient in cocktails, and is believed to have medicinal properties and health benefits. Mama Juana is a staple in Dominican culture and is often enjoyed during social gatherings and celebrations. The drink has a rich history and is deeply rooted in the country’s traditions and customs.

Mama Juana is typically made from a mixture of ingredients, including rum, red wine, honey, and tree bark, which are soaked together in a bottle for several days. The resulting drink is a strong and flavorful concoction with a unique taste and aroma. Are there any local beers to try in Punta Cana?

Yes, there are several local beers to try in Punta Cana, including Presidente, which is the most popular beer in the Dominican Republic. Presidente is a light and crisp lager that’s perfect for hot days and tropical nights, and it’s often served chilled and straight from the bottle. Other local beers include Bohemia and Quisqueya, which offer a range of styles and flavors to suit every taste and preference. Many resorts and hotels also offer local beer as part of their all-inclusive beverage packages, making it easy to try the local brews.

In Punta Cana, you can find local beer at most bars, restaurants, and resorts, where it’s often served with a squeeze of fresh lime juice and a sprinkle of salt.
